Charlie at Hannaford

Those of you who shop at Hannaford may remember the guy who sat on the bench in the front of the store. Whenever I saw him there, I thought how wonderful it was that the store management let him claim that space for his own. The people there were more wonderful than I ever imagined.

I was really thankful when Alison mentioned during our prayer time that Charlie had died. It is a sacred act to remember those who are no longer with us, particularly those who maybe don't have a family or a community to remember them.

Erica sent this wonderful article about Charlie that made me cry. People are truly beautiful.

It makes me think, who can I get to know as a friend. There are so many people I don't think I would have anything in common with. There are so many people that I can't imagine being friends with. Maybe these are the people who have the most to teach me if I would just open my life to them.
